A technical report is a formal document that presents the results of research. It typically outlines complex information in a clear and concise manner, utilizing tables, figures, and visualizations to effectively convey data. The purpose of a technical report is to inform stakeholders about specific technical subjects, often serving as a basis for decision-making or further exploration.
- Commonly used in fields such as engineering, science, and technology.
- Adheres to specific formatting guidelines and conventions.
- Encompasses an overview, methodology, results, discussion, and conclusion.

Technical Report
A Technical Report Number functions as a specific identifier for each publication. It typically includes a set of letters, numbers, and sometimes hyphens or slashes. This scheme allows for organized tracking and retrieval of research papers.
The Technical Report Number is often shown on the front cover of a report, as well as in catalogs.
It can also be used to a reference point for related documents. A Technical Report Number is crucial for maintaining accuracy in technical works.
